Water damage

A water leak in your home can be a real health and safety risk. Water damage can not only lead to mold growth but can also cause structural damage to your home. You need to take the correct steps to repair the damage before it becomes more severe.

First, determine the source of the leak. It's a good idea seek the advice of a professional contractor when you're not sure the source.

The best way to pinpoint the source of the leak is by examining the walls around the window. There are two signs to look out for: discoloration and the smell of musty. The discoloration is caused due to water that has accumulated around the window. The smell that is musty is due to a poorly installed or leaking window.

Also, you should check the glass. If there are tears or cracks then you'll need to replace them. If you're unable to repair the glass, you might have to replace the window itself.

The most important part of repairing water damage is finding the source of the leak. This can often be difficult however it is doable. You may have to remove an area of the wall to access the source.

If you're uncomfortable with the task, it may be an ideal idea to have an expert handle it. Even the most well-designed windows can suffer water damage.

Inquire about your homeowner's insurance policy to find out whether your policy covers the replacement cost of your windows. If you can provide proof of the damage your insurance provider may cover the cost of replacing the window.

Wood frames with rotted wood

You should inspect the frame for damage before you replace it or repair it. Rotted wood will display signs like cracks and discoloration. This is caused by exposure to water. Typically, the corners at the bottom and the sill are the areas that rot takes place. If you notice signs of rot, it is imperative to act immediately to prevent further damage.

Wood rot is a regular problem for older homes. Luckily, it can be easily treated. It's an easy fix that requires basic carpentry skills. It is recommended to hire professionals if you're not confident in your abilities.

There are numerous ways to fix a rotten window frame. You can replace the entire window, or replace the wood around the window, or just replace the wood that has been damaged. If you are replacing the entire frame, you will require a new wooden frame with a similar thickness and grain pattern to the original. This will ensure that the new frame blends with the existing frame.

Rotted wood can be fixed by using two-part epoxy. Mix the epoxy together according to the instructions provided by the manufacturer and then apply it to the holes or cracks in the frame. The epoxy should be cured within 24 hours.

Rotted wood can be replaced using a custom wood insert. It is possible to use a die grinder or prybar to remove the wood that has rotted from the frame. You may also want to consider buying a hammer and chisel to help you remove the rotted pieces.

Wood that is rotten can be replaced, but it may require some effort. It is essential to remove any wood chips from the wood before replacing the pieces that have rotted. This will prevent the damage to the wood surrounding it.

Shifting foundation

If you own a brand new or old house, foundation problems can cause a lot of stress. Foundation problems can cause structural failure and cost-intensive repairs. This is why it's important to identify the most obvious indicators of foundation problems before they become serious.

The first thing to know is that there are a variety of reasons why your foundation might be moving. The most common reasons are tree roots, insufficient drainage, poor compaction and expansion and contraction of the soil beneath your home.

A professional inspection of your home is the best way to determine the cause of foundation movement. This can be accomplished by a foundation repair specialist.

If a foundation is moving it can cause cracks and gaps in floors, walls, and windows. It can also cause broken ceilings, door frames, and uneven floors. It may even cause your chimney to lean or separate from the rest of your house.


Another indicator of shifting foundation is hairline fissures. A hairline fissure is an incredibly small crack that connects the corner of windows to the corner of an area. While it may appear small at first but a hairline fissure may quickly turn into a major problem.

Sagging floors are another indicator of a foundation shifting. This may be due to soil expansion or contraction when it is wet or dry. A yard drain that is maintained to manage soil moisture can help prevent this.

Windows and doors that do not open or close properly are another sign of a foundation that is shifting. The doors might not fit inside the sill or the windows might stick. If this is the case, it's time to act.

Foggy windows

Fogging windows in your home can be a nuisance and can impact your home's energy efficiency. Fogged windows are common in older homes, because of the window seal being defective. The outside air can enter the house through the window seal, causing condensation and moisture to build up.

Luckily, there are window and door repairs to this issue. One solution is to drill tiny holes in the glass to allow the moisture to escape. A second option involves injecting dry agents through one hole. Incorporating a special air filter to keep dust and insects away can also help.

The most expensive option involves replacing the entire window unit. It's a major project and can take up all day. Another alternative is to replace the frame and sash of the window. This is a more efficient option in terms of cost.

Do-it-yourself kits are also offered to remove window fog. These kits allow you to make small holes and eliminate moisture. To make your window more energy efficient you can add more coatings of paint, krypton or argon.

The best method to avoid window fog is to install a double or triple paned window. This will stop cold air from entering your home and allows heat to flow through during summer. In addition, the majority of double pane windows of high-quality come with an outer and an inner seal.

Replacement of the entire sash

It is costly to replace the entire window sash when you require repair. Sometimes it is possible to fix the issue using a partial repair. If the damage is serious, however, you might require replacing the entire component.

The sash is a window element that holds the glass panes. It is composed of a horizontal frame and an upright frame with tabs. Glazing compound holds the glass in place. The glazing compound needs to be evenly spread over the sash-rabbet. This is essential because it seals the wood for many years.

Cracks or damage to a window's frame can cause cracks and other issues. This can lead to drafts and insect damage. If the glass panes are not damaged, it can be repaired with window putty. It can be applied using an instrument and left to dry before painting.

After the glass has been removed, you should inspect the interior and exterior frame for damage. Any visible damage must be addressed as soon as is feasible. Check the jamb liner to see if there are any gaps between pivot pins.
